If you’re still reeling after watching Wicked, you can step back into Oz at Resorts World Sentosa.
Here are all the Wicked experiences:
🧹🫧 Meet and Greets with Elphaba, Glinda, the Wizard and the Ozians at Universal Studios Singapore
🛍️ Exclusive Wicked merchandise at the Silver Screen Store in Universal Studios Singapore
🍽️ Wicked-themed food at participating restaurants around Resorts World Sentosa
💫 Limitless Lights: An Ozmopolitan Display of Music and Lights at the Lake of Dreams (free)
✨ Journey Through Oz at Sentosa Sensoryscape (free)
📸 Wicked photobooths at the Grand Steps near the Lake of Dreams ($12 per session)
👗 The Wardrobe of Wicked: A Curated Costume Display inside Universal Studios Singapore (new — was not available when I visited)
🗓️ 10 Nov 2025 – 4 Jan 2026
📍 Resorts World Sentosa

If you’re a fan of Wicked and find yourself wanting more after the show, Resorts World Sentosa in Singapore offers an immersive extension of the musical’s magic that’s truly worth exploring. One of my favorite attractions is the meet and greets at Universal Studios Singapore where you can interact with beloved characters like Elphaba, Glinda, and the Wizard. It’s not just a photo opportunity; the actors are in character and bring the story to life, making it a delightful experience for fans of all ages. For those who love memorabilia, the Silver Screen Store houses exclusive Wicked merchandise that isn’t available anywhere else in Singapore. From apparel to keepsakes, these items make perfect souvenirs or gifts for fellow Wicked enthusiasts. Foodies will enjoy the Wicked-themed menu at various restaurants around Resorts World Sentosa. The creatively named dishes are both a feast for the eyes and the palate, allowing you to taste the world of Oz. A highlight for me was the Limitless Lights show at the Lake of Dreams. This free event combines spectacular music with vibrant lights, creating an 'Ozmopolitan' display that enchants visitors each night and beautifully captures the spirit of the musical. Also not to be missed is the Journey Through Oz at Sentosa Sensoryscape, a sensory experience that immerses you in the sights and sounds of Oz – a fantastic free activity that adds depth to the Wicked fandom. If you want a more personal memento, the Wicked photobooths near the Lake of Dreams offer professional photos, providing a unique keepsake for just a small fee. Lastly, the newly introduced Wardrobe of Wicked inside Universal Studios Singapore showcases an incredible curated costume display. Seeing these iconic outfits up close adds another layer of appreciation for the production design and craftsmanship behind the musical. Visiting these experiences between 10 Nov 2025 and 4 Jan 2026 will allow you to fully celebrate Wicked beyond the stage in Singapore. Whether it’s interacting with characters, picking up exclusive merch, enjoying themed cuisine, or marveling at the light displays, there’s something here to keep the magic alive long after the curtain falls.
